Why Cold Brew Sales Don’t Cool Down in the Winter
Most people consider cold brew a summer staple because it’s icy, smooth, and refreshing when the temperature spikes. But here’s the reality: cold brew sales stay strong all year. If you manage a C-store or quick-service restaurant, pulling cold brew from your lineup once the weather dips could cost you. Instead of treating it as a seasonal novelty, treating cold brew as a permanent fixture in your beverage program opens the door to high-margin, repeat revenue 365 days a year.
